A fair working life
We have over 2,000 employees in five different countries under almost a hundred different job titles. Over 60 percent of our employees have a permanent contract, and the average age of our employees is a bit over 30 years.
We work with enthusiasm and a helping hand. Our annual employee survey reveals enthusiasm as the largest factor in well-being at the workplace. This is because many of our employees get to work with their hobbies and passions.
Leadership should be of equal quality. Good leadership means equality at the workplace and a zero-tolerance policy against inappropriate behaviour and bullying. Good leadership also means constant improvement and constant learning, which we strongly encourage our employees to engage in.
Health and safety
We pay close attention to mental health and our goal is to lower the number of absences relating to mental health issues. Mental health also has an important role when coaching new leaders and cooperating with our occupational healthcare.
To help us tackle mental health related issues, we have a program with clear goals and indicators, and make an effort to identify signs of exhaustion and struggle early on. We underline open and freequent communication between healthcare professionals, management and employees.
At our logistics centre, our staff is our priority. We cherish their safety by performing regular audits and keeping the workers’ surroundings clean. Automated logistics services increase safety, because it means less forklifts, improved ergonomics and less physical work.

Taxes, growth and investments
At Broman Group economic growth happens through growth, sustainability and employment. Without profitable and responsible growth, we would not have been able to create new jobs and make all of our investments.
We want to renew and grow by acting consciously. Some key events in the past years that have led to our growth are expanding Motonet to Sweden and investing over 70 million euros in our logistics centre in Kerava.

Circular economy
We make sustainable choices for our customers. We choose products that have as transparent as possible supply chain, that endure time and use, that can be recycled and that are packaged effectively.
Everything does not need to be owned. We let trailers to consumers and special tools to car repair shops, and we continue to expand our rental services in the future to ensure better economic choices.
Did you know that many spare parts are recyclable? We send core returns back to the manufacturers, where they are made into new spare parts. We also help you recycle old batteries, old tyres and car workshop equipment correctly and sustainably.
In waste management our goal is to minimise the creation of waste and to recycle as much as possible. Most of the waste is packaging materials, such as plastic. All plastic and cardboard from our daily operations are either sent to a recycling facility or reused.
Energy efficiency
Because building makes a significant part of the ecological footprint of our property, we want to impact the choices involved in the process by taking an active role.
We mainly operate in property owned by Broman Group. We make sure to plan and build energy efficient buildings and constantly improve the efficiency along the way. Energy efficiency consists of energy efficient materials, technical solutions, detailed maintenance planning and choices that last a lifetime. The ecological efficiency has been improved through solar and geothermal energy. Over 1.8 million kilowatt hours come from solar energy each year.
Emissions
We are currently calculating our carbon dioxide emissions to better understand our impact on climate change and how to combat it best.
Transporting goods is a big part of our operations. We take advantage of our own transport and logistics services, which allows us to plan the processes ourselves and minimise the ecological impact.
For international shipments we prefer boats, and for national shipments we optimise both deliveries and returns. We choose partners that make active efforts to minimise their emissions and that use renewable energy whenever possible. Our partners use modern transportation technologies that fit much cargo and run on biofuel.
